Meanings of preponder
- Alt. of Preponderancy
- The quality or state of being preponderant; superiority or excess of weight, influence, or power, etc.; an outweighing.
- The excess of weight of that part of a canon behind the trunnions over that in front of them.
- Preponderating; outweighing; overbalancing; -- used literally and figuratively; as, a preponderant weight; of preponderant importance.
- To exceed in weight; hence, to incline or descend, as the scale of a balance; figuratively, to exceed in influence, power, etc.; hence; to incline to one side; as, the affirmative side preponderated.
- To outweigh; to overpower by weight; to exceed in weight; to overbalance.
- To overpower by stronger or moral power.
- To cause to prefer; to incline; to decide.
- of Preponderate
- of Preponderate
- In a preponderating manner; preponderantly.
- The act or state of preponderating; preponderance; as, a preponderation of reasons.
